Output 38aebe59b7f3e124b17860a2454dd3cbad227a0661eb48e3be692e48fdcaad77:0

value
65877675
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b34bfbc74026741f27fda0c256a2356c80306ee8 OP_EQUALVERIFY OP_CHECKSIG
address
1HM2ymLUaJZP6WLM3a38ELAbeiYbmQ5RCA
transaction
38aebe59b7f3e124b17860a2454dd3cbad227a0661eb48e3be692e48fdcaad77
spent
true